๐ Hindu Astrology View on Snake Dreams
In Hindu astrology, snake dreams are often linked with karma, Rahu-Ketu influence, spiritual lessons, and hidden energy.
Snakes are respected symbols in Hindu tradition because they connect with divine consciousness and cosmic power.
Rahu and Ketu Connection
Rahu and Ketu are shadow planets associated with illusion, karmic patterns, fear, confusion, and spiritual growth.
A dead snake dream may appear during strong Rahu-Ketu periods in life, especially when someone experiences:
- Confusion
- Emotional instability
- Sudden endings
- Spiritual questioning
- Unexpected transformation
Connection With Lord Shiva ๐๏ธ
Lord Shiva is often shown with a snake around his neck, symbolizing mastery over fear and ego.
Dreaming of a dead snake can sometimes reflect your struggle with ego, emotional control, or spiritual awakening.
The dream may encourage humility, balance, and inner peace.
